43/*
44 * The input manager is the core of the system event processing.
45 *
Michael Wright63534162020-07-02 14:38:16 +010046 * The input manager has three components.
Michael Wrightd02c5b62014-02-10 15:10:22 -080047 *
Prabir Pradhan28efc192019-11-05 01:10:04 +000048 * 1. The InputReader class starts a thread that reads and preprocesses raw input events, applies
Siarhei Vishniakouba0a8752021-09-14 14:43:25 -070049 * policy, and posts messages to a queue managed by the UnwantedInteractionBlocker.
50 * 2. The UnwantedInteractionBlocker is responsible for removing unwanted interactions. For example,
51 * this could be a palm on the screen. This stage would alter the event stream to remove either
52 * partially (some of the pointers) or fully (all touches) the unwanted interaction. The events
53 * are processed on the InputReader thread, without any additional queue. The events are then
Siarhei Vishniakou98996032022-08-03 11:54:47 -070054 * posted to the queue managed by the InputProcessor.
55 * 3. The InputProcessor class starts a thread to communicate with the device-specific
56 * IInputProcessor HAL. It then waits on the queue of events from UnwantedInteractionBlocker,
57 * processes the events (for example, applies a classification to the events), and queues them
58 * for the InputDispatcher.
Siarhei Vishniakouba0a8752021-09-14 14:43:25 -070059 * 4. The InputDispatcher class starts a thread that waits for new events on the
Michael Wright63534162020-07-02 14:38:16 +010060 * previous queue and asynchronously dispatches them to applications.
Michael Wrightd02c5b62014-02-10 15:10:22 -080061 *
Michael Wright63534162020-07-02 14:38:16 +010062 * By design, none of these classes share any internal state. Moreover, all communication is
63 * done one way from the InputReader to the InputDispatcher and never the reverse. All
64 * classes may interact with the InputDispatchPolicy, however.
Michael Wrightd02c5b62014-02-10 15:10:22 -080065 *
66 * The InputManager class never makes any calls into Java itself. Instead, the
67 * InputDispatchPolicy is responsible for performing all external interactions with the
68 * system, including calling DVM services.
69 */
